Chelo Alonso was a Cuban actress who became very famous in Italian movies during the 1960s. She was born Isabel Apolonia García Hernández on April 10, 1933, in Cuba. She passed away on February 20, 2019. Chelo Alonso was known for playing strong, exciting characters and for her amazing dance scenes in films.

About Chelo Alonso

Chelo Alonso was born Isabel Apolonia García Hernández in a place called Central Lugareño, in Camagüey, Cuba. Her father was Cuban, and her mother was Mexican.

She first became well-known in Cuba because she was an amazing dancer. She was a big hit at Cuba's National Theatre in Havana.

Soon after, she became a new and exciting dancer at the Folies Bergère in Paris, France. People called her the "new Josephine Baker", who was another famous dancer who performed there. Chelo Alonso was also called the "Cuban H-Bomb". She mixed Afro-Cuban dance styles from her home country with energetic dance moves.

Her Movie Career

Chelo Alonso first became known around the world in a 1959 movie called Nel segno di Roma (which means Sheba and the Gladiator). In this film, she starred alongside famous actors like Anita Ekberg.

Many of Chelo Alonso's movies were exciting adventure movies. They were often like the popular film Le fatiche di Ercole (Hercules), which starred Steve Reeves. Hercules was a very popular type of movie, and it led to many other films trying to be like it.

These adventure movies needed actors with unique looks, and Chelo Alonso's dark beauty was perfect. She even starred with Steve Reeves himself in two movies: Goliath and the Barbarians (1959) and Morgan il pirata (1960). For her role in Goliath and the Barbarians, Chelo Alonso won an award for being "Italian Cinema's Female Discovery".

Later Life and Retirement

In 1960, while making Morgan il pirata, Chelo Alonso met and married Aldo Pomilia. He worked as a production manager and producer for movies. After they made a movie together called Quattro notti con Alba (Desert War) in 1962, they had a son named Aldino Pomilia. Chelo then took a break from acting.

Later, she made a brief appearance in a very famous western movie called The Good, the Bad and the Ugly (1966). She was not credited for this small part.

Her husband, Aldo, then helped her make a successful return to movies. She starred with Tomas Milian, who was also from Havana, in a popular western movie called Corri uomo corri (Run, Man, Run). Many people think this was her best movie role.

Chelo then had another small role in a western movie called La notte dei serpenti (Nest of Vipers). After this, she stopped making films and focused on Italian television.

After her husband passed away in 1986, Chelo Alonso moved to the city of Siena in Tuscany, Italy. She fully retired from acting. She started a business breeding cats and also owned a four-star hotel.

Chelo Alonso died on February 20, 2019, when she was 85 years old.
